The National Debt

How are we losing our liberties?  One way to look at this question is by considerng the total accumulated debt owed by the the United States Government--i.e., by the taxpayer.  According to the U.S. Treasury, the total accumulated national debt as of September 2, 2010 was $13.44 trillion dollars.  With almost 310 million people in the U.S., that works out to about $43,500 per man, woman, and child.  And that figure grows each day as we pile on more and more debt.
